We often style our hair using heat styling methods such as hairdryers, straighteners and curlers or chemical processes such as dyeing, rebonding and perming. We do all sort of things to our hair to make it look nice, but did you know that all of these actions can stress and damage our hair? Well, if you don't, now you know! Even seemingly innocuous things like combing, twirling and tying our hair (simple ponytails or braids) can lead to damage.

And who are behind all these? The FIVE EVIL HAIR STRESS BROTHERS!

They use their super powers to create stress for our hair, so that our hair will look like theirs — fried, damaged and tangled.

You know, I know, we face them everyday. Let's see what makes them tick:
1. Blow drying: The process of blow-drying removes moisture from the hair, both outside and inside the hair — leaving hair dry, brittle and susceptible for further damage.
2. Combing: Combing through wet hair causes great hair damage as the hair follicle is at it's most fragile state. Likewise, the friction caused by coming through dry hair can form hair knots which makes hair prone to unnecessary breakage.
3. Split Ends: The ends of your hair are the oldest and driest parts. When the protective hair cuticle is destroyed at the end of the hair, the hair splits into two or more parts.
4. Dryness: Exposure to the sun, wind or even air-conditioning can result in hair dryness. The hair cuticle that protects the hair is weakened and is unable to retain moisture within the cuticles of the hair.
5. Hair Breakage: Besides daily heat styling, blow drying and brushing, other seemingly harmless actions like tying your hair into a tight ponytail or twirling your hair with your fingers exert excessive stress on your hair, resulting in hair breakage.

Today's post is going to be a review of the Tory Burch Lip Color lipstick.

The Tory Burch Lip Color range has 12 distinctive shades — each designed to flatter a variety of skin tones. Extending from the original signature lip color, Pas du Tout, the collection ranges from tomboy neutrals to feminine pinks and bold brights. This modern formula represents the ideal balance of sheer yet vivid color and rich texture with a weightless finish.

The lipstick is encased in a rectangular case with gold and orange fretwork design.

It looks like a super-chic accessory in itself. Absolutely gorgeous~! ♥

It is available in 12 shades. I got it in the original signature shade, Pas du Tout

Fun Fact: Pas du Tout — Tory's signature color named after the French version of "she loves me, she loves me not" (a game of pulling petals off a daisy).

The lipstick bullet has Tory Burch's logo embossed on it and has a faint, pleasant scent. The shade, Pas du Tout, comes in a universally flattering pinky-peachy nude tone with subtle beautiful gold shimmer.

Here are the swatches from 1 to 5 and 10 swipes, with and without flash:

As you can tell from the swatches, this shade is ultra sheer. It would take 3 or more swipes to make it noticeable on lips; however, it doesn't really give much color to the lips — I guess that's the only drawback.

On the positive side, it is a fairly moisturizing lipstick with a very creamy-balmy texture, that glides on smoothly and melts onto the lips. It doesn't highlight lip lines or dryness, and doesn't leave a sticky after-feel. I find the color has an average lasting power; some touch-ups are needed after eating and/or drinking.

Overall, I love it! I love how it enhances my lips color, keeping them looking natural, smooth and moist. Sometimes, I would top it off with a lip gloss for an extra sheen. I think it is a perfect ultra-sheer nude shade for everyday wear, and would look good on many skin tones.

If you have pigmented lips or if you are looking for a lipstick that gives an intense color, this shade isn't for you.

The first thing I noticed was my skin didn't get that squeaky, tight feeling or irritation after cleansing. And it dried out my non-inflamed pimples in a few days, but it wasn't very effective against my inflamed pimples. Therefore, in my opinion, it is more effective against non-inflamed pimples like whiteheads, flesh-colored bumps.

Another thing I noticed was that this AC Clinic White-Trouble Bubble Cleanser gets used up faster than the AC Clinic Daily Acne Foam Cleanser, even though they have the same amount of product (150ml). So it may be a bit costly lah. Side information: I usually use one pump and it is sufficient to cleanse my face.

Overall, the Etude House AC Clinic White-Trouble Bubble Cleanser cleanses the skin without overly stripping away the natural oils and moisture. I think it is by far the most gentlest acne cleanser I have ever come across. Ideal for sensitive skin! The only drawback is it's not very effective against inflamed acne.

If you have a lot of red inflamed pimples, I would recommend the AC Clinic Daily Acne Foam Cleanser instead of this bubble one. Pick this only if your pimples are mostly non-inflamed zits.
